What is the Flexible Spending Account Election Form?
The Flexible Spending Account Election Form is a vital document for both employees and employers, facilitating the enrollment in Flexible Spending Accounts (FSAs). This form enables employees to manage healthcare costs by allowing pre-tax contributions that can be used for eligible medical expenses. The form itself outlines the enrollment options, various benefits associated with FSAs, and specifies annual contribution limits, aligning with the objectives of efficient financial planning.
Among the benefits available through FSAs are tax savings that directly impact an employee’s net income. Furthermore, the form includes details on how employers can play an active role in supporting employees through the benefits offered.

Who is eligible to use the Flexible Spending Account Election Form?
Employees who are part of an employer-sponsored Flexible Spending Account plan are eligible to use this form. Employers may have specific enrollment periods, so check with your HR department for eligibility requirements.
Are there deadlines for submitting the Flexible Spending Account Election Form?
Yes, submission deadlines typically align with your employer’s open enrollment periods. It's important to confirm specific dates with your HR department to ensure timely processing.
How do I submit the Flexible Spending Account Election Form?
You can submit the completed form electronically through pdfFiller, or print and submit it in person or via mail based on your employer's instructions. Double-check submission methods with the HR team.
What supporting documents are required when submitting the form?
In most cases, no additional documents are required for the Flexible Spending Account Election Form. However, your employer might request identification or proof of dependents for certain elections.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include incomplete fields, incorrect contribution amounts, and failing to sign the form. Review your entries carefully before submission to avoid these errors.
How long does it take for FSA elections to be processed?
Processing times can vary, but typically your elections are processed promptly after submission. Confirm with your HR department for specific turnaround times.
Can I make changes to my Flexible Spending Account elections after submission?
Changes may be allowed under certain circumstances, such as qualifying life events. Contact your HR department to discuss the possibility of amending your elections post-submission.
